Alloy Steel A335 P22 Pipe

Alloy Steel A335 P22 Pipe

Heavy-Duty High-Pressure Steam and Reheat Service Pipes

ASTM A335 P22, often referred to as "2-1/4 Chrome," is the heavy-duty standard for extreme temperature and high-pressure service in the power generation and petrochemical industries. It offers significantly higher creep strength and thermal resistance compared to P11 and P12 grades. Engineered for use in temperatures up to 600°C, it is the primary choice for critical steam lines, hot reheat piping, and heavy-wall headers where structural integrity under extreme thermal stress is non-negotiable.

Mechanical Properties

Property Value (Min)
Yield Strength (0.2% Offset) 205 MPa (30,000 psi)
Tensile Strength 415 MPa (60,000 psi)
Elongation 30%
Hardness (Brinell) Max 163 HBW

Chemical Composition (%)

Element A335 P22 Percentage
Carbon (C)0.05 - 0.15
Chromium (Cr)1.90 - 2.60
Molybdenum (Mo)0.87 - 1.13
Manganese (Mn)0.30 - 0.60
Silicon (Si)0.50 max
Phosphorus (P)0.025 max
Sulphur (S)0.025 max

Applications & Uses

Power Generation

Essential for main steam and hot reheat piping in thermal and nuclear plants.

Hydro-Processing

Widely used in reactors and heavy refining units handling corrosive fluids.

Boiler Headers

Primary choice for high-temperature steam collectors and furnace piping.
